thespitalfieldstrust.com Security Report Summary

thespitalfieldstrust.com received a security score of 53 out of 100 in Guard's comprehensive security analysis, classified as "Elevated Risk". This report covers The Spitalfields Historic Building Trust's website security posture. The Spitalfields Historic Building Trust operates in the Non-profit industry in United Kingdom.

The Spitalfields Trust is a UK-based charitable building preservation trust established in 1977, focused on conserving historic buildings primarily in East London, Kent, and Wales. It operates as a small non-profit entity managed by trustees and a small staff, emphasizing community engagement and heritage conservation. The website serves as an informational and donation platform highlighting their custodianship of notable historic properties such as Dennis Severs House and 19 Princelet Street. Technically, the website is built on WordPress with Elementor, employing modern web technologies and responsive design, though performance is moderate and accessibility is basic. Security posture is adequate with HTTPS usage but lacks advanced security headers and explicit policies. WHOIS data is missing, raising concerns about domain registration legitimacy, though the website content and business information appear consistent and trustworthy. Privacy and cookie policies are absent, indicating compliance gaps. Overall, the site is functional and professional but would benefit from enhanced security and privacy transparency.

Company:

The Spitalfields Historic Building Trust

Description:

The Spitalfields Trust is a building preservation trust and charity established in 1977 focused on campaigning for and preserving historic buildings, primarily in Spitalfields, East London, Kent, and Wales. It manages and conserves historic properties such as Dennis Severs House, 19 Princelet Street, and Charing Palace. The Trust is run by a Board of Trustees and a small staff, emphasizing low running costs and community involvement.

Key Services:
Historic building preservation and restorationPublic tours and events at heritage sitesCampaigning for historic environment protectionMuseum custodianship
